Professional Background
Heather McDevitt is an accomplished professional in the field of public relations and talent publicity. Currently serving as a Senior Account Executive at Rogers & Cowan PMK, a leading global communications agency, she specializes in creating impactful publicity strategies that enhance the visibility and reputation of high-profile clients. Her journey in public relations has been marked by continuous growth, demonstrating her dedication and expertise in navigating the complex media landscape.
Heather began her career at Rogers & Cowan as an Assistant Account Executive, where she quickly made a name for herself through her innovative approach and ability to build strong relationships with clients and media representatives alike. Her exceptional performance led to advancement to the role of Account Executive, and eventually to Senior Account Executive. At each stage of her career, Heather has consistently exceeded expectations and contributed to the success of her clients, proving to be an invaluable asset to her team.
Prior to her tenure at Rogers & Cowan, Heather gathered diverse experience in various public relations and marketing roles. Her background includes noteworthy positions such as the Gameday Public Relations Staff for the New York Football Giants and as an Account Coordinator at Coyne. These experiences honed her skills in event management, client services, and media outreach, giving her a robust foundation on which to build her career. Moreover, Heather's involvement with elite organizations like the NBA, where she served in roles such as NBA Draft Media Escort and Team USA Public Relations Game Day Staff, showcases her ability to operate under high-pressure environments and manage critical communications strategically.
Education and Achievements
Heather McDevitt graduated with a Bachelor of Arts in Public Relations from Penn State University, where she achieved a commendable GPA of 3.52. This educational background laid the groundwork for her successful career in public relations. While at Penn State, she also engaged in practical experiences that further enriched her understanding of the industry, including internships with the Penn State Men's Basketball Team and the New York Mets. These early career opportunities not only equipped Heather with hands-on skills but also offered her the chance to network with key figures in sports and entertainment.
